Moderate 4.6 Quake Near Boulder Creek Sparks Safety Warnings

Story summary
  • A magnitude 4.6 earthquake struck near Boulder Creek, California, at 1:41 a.m. on April 2, 2026.
  • The U.S. Geological Survey noted that most residents live in earthquake-resistant structures.
  • Some minor damage occurred, such as broken dishes, but no serious injuries were reported.
  • Experts warned the quake may signal a period of increased seismic activity and urged residents to prepare for potential larger quakes.
  • Public safety officials are currently assessing the situation.
